A Rare late Victorian Cadbury's Cocoa 'Absolutely Pure' enamel sign,by Falkirk Iron Co Falkirk, in full colour enamel, depicting horse drawn carriage outside a Cadbury's confectionary shop, 91 x 122cm Footnotes:This sign was found in a shed in Maidstone, and reportedly made up one of the walls.For further information on this lot please visit Bonhams.com

Rare 18th century Birmingham enamel bonbonniere, circa 1760, modelled as a grinning tiger laid upon a grassy sgraffito mound, the base decorated with a lion hunting scene after Antonio Tempesta, within a polychrome scroll surround, H5.5cm D6cmCondition Report: General wear commensurate with age and use, including some surface cracks to enamel, loss to enamel of one ear, and enamel losses around base.Underside with crack through upper left section, and scratches.Please enquire directly with saleroom for further details.
German - 8-day weight driven Vienna regulator, with a carved pediment and turned pendants and finials, fully glazed case door with visible dial, pendulum and weight, two part enamel dial with Roman numerals, pierced steel hands and seconds dial, single train timepiece movement with a deadbeat escapement. With a brass cased weight, pendulum and pully.Dimensions: Height: 130cm Length/Width: 35cm Depth/Diameter: 14cm
Very Rare 'Caterpillar Club' Lapel Badge with Red Enamel Eyes. Good Pin in very good Condition. 20mm long, Awarded to Sgt W.A. Poulton who's name is engraved to the rear of the badge. There is a large book of research on the recipient of the story of Him and the events of the shooting down of his Halifax Aircraft during WW2 over enemy territory. See multiple photos.
